Mosquito bites, Ross River Virus is a mosquito-borne disease that is becoming more common. It causes arthritis and flu-like symptoms which can be severe and debilitating.
The symptoms vary from person to person but include painful and/or swollen joints, sore
muscles, aching tendons, skin rashes, fever, tiredness, headaches and swollen lymph nodes. Less common
symptoms include sore eyes, a sore throat, nausea, and tingling in the palms of the hands or soles of the feet.
